( ! ) Notice: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>fluentformpro</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.0.) in /srv/www/advital/current/web/wp/wp-includes/functions.php on line 6121
Call Stack
#TimeMemoryFunctionLocation
10.0002464728{main}( ).../index.php:0
20.0003466040require( '/srv/www/advital/current/web/wp/wp-blog-header.php ).../index.php:5
30.0004475664require_once( '/srv/www/advital/current/web/wp/wp-load.php ).../wp-blog-header.php:13
40.0005477056require_once( '/srv/www/advital/current/web/wp-config.php ).../wp-load.php:55
50.01271211296require_once( '/srv/www/advital/current/web/wp/wp-settings.php ).../wp-config.php:9
60.5669104193920do_action( $hook_name = 'plugins_loaded' ).../wp-settings.php:578
70.5669104194136WP_Hook->do_action( $args = [0 => ''] ).../plugin.php:517
80.5669104194136WP_Hook->apply_filters( $value = '', $args = [0 => ''] ).../class-wp-hook.php:348
90.6873120984392{closure:/srv/www/advital/current/web/app/plugins/fluentformpro/fluentformpro.php:656-660}( '' ).../class-wp-hook.php:324
100.6874120990784include( '/srv/www/advital/current/web/app/plugins/fluentformpro/libs/ff_plugin_updater/ff-fluentform-pro-update.php ).../fluentformpro.php:658
110.6886121252784__( $text = 'Fluent Forms Pro Add On', $domain = 'fluentformpro' ).../ff-fluentform-pro-update.php:42
120.6886121252784translate( $text = 'Fluent Forms Pro Add On', $domain = 'fluentformpro' ).../l10n.php:307
130.6886121252784get_translations_for_domain( $domain = 'fluentformpro' ).../l10n.php:195
140.6887121252784_load_textdomain_just_in_time( $domain = 'fluentformpro' ).../l10n.php:1409
150.6891121258104_doing_it_wrong( $function_name = '_load_textdomain_just_in_time', $message = 'Translation loading for the <code>fluentformpro</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later.', $version = '6.7.0' ).../l10n.php:1371
160.6891121259448wp_trigger_error( $function_name = '', $message = '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>fluentformpro</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.'..., $error_level = ??? ).../functions.php:6061
170.6894121266248trigger_error( $message = '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>fluentformpro</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.'..., $error_level = 1024 ).../functions.php:6121

( ! ) Notice: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>woo-cart-abandonment-recovery</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.0.) in /srv/www/advital/current/web/wp/wp-includes/functions.php on line 6121
Call Stack
#TimeMemoryFunctionLocation
10.0002464728{main}( ).../index.php:0
20.0003466040require( '/srv/www/advital/current/web/wp/wp-blog-header.php ).../index.php:5
30.0004475664require_once( '/srv/www/advital/current/web/wp/wp-load.php ).../wp-blog-header.php:13
40.0005477056require_once( '/srv/www/advital/current/web/wp-config.php ).../wp-load.php:55
50.01271211296require_once( '/srv/www/advital/current/web/wp/wp-settings.php ).../wp-config.php:9
60.5669104193920do_action( $hook_name = 'plugins_loaded' ).../wp-settings.php:578
70.5669104194136WP_Hook->do_action( $args = [0 => ''] ).../plugin.php:517
80.5669104194136WP_Hook->apply_filters( $value = '', $args = [0 => ''] ).../class-wp-hook.php:348
90.7647129214432CARTFLOWS_CA_Loader->load_libraries( '' ).../class-wp-hook.php:324
100.7651129224944__( $text = 'Quick Feedback', $domain = 'woo-cart-abandonment-recovery' ).../class-cartflows-ca-loader.php:310
110.7651129224944translate( $text = 'Quick Feedback', $domain = 'woo-cart-abandonment-recovery' ).../l10n.php:307
120.7651129224944get_translations_for_domain( $domain = 'woo-cart-abandonment-recovery' ).../l10n.php:195
130.7651129224944_load_textdomain_just_in_time( $domain = 'woo-cart-abandonment-recovery' ).../l10n.php:1409
140.7653129226280_doing_it_wrong( $function_name = '_load_textdomain_just_in_time', $message = 'Translation loading for the <code>woo-cart-abandonment-recovery</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later.', $version = '6.7.0' ).../l10n.php:1371
150.7653129227624wp_trigger_error( $function_name = '', $message = '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>woo-cart-abandonment-recovery</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added'..., $error_level = ??? ).../functions.php:6061
160.7655129228264trigger_error( $message = '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>woo-cart-abandonment-recovery</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added'..., $error_level = 1024 ).../functions.php:6121

( ! ) Notice: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>hustle</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.0.) in /srv/www/advital/current/web/wp/wp-includes/functions.php on line 6121
Call Stack
#TimeMemoryFunctionLocation
10.0002464728{main}( ).../index.php:0
20.0003466040require( '/srv/www/advital/current/web/wp/wp-blog-header.php ).../index.php:5
30.0004475664require_once( '/srv/www/advital/current/web/wp/wp-load.php ).../wp-blog-header.php:13
40.0005477056require_once( '/srv/www/advital/current/web/wp-config.php ).../wp-load.php:55
50.01271211296require_once( '/srv/www/advital/current/web/wp/wp-settings.php ).../wp-config.php:9
60.5669104193920do_action( $hook_name = 'plugins_loaded' ).../wp-settings.php:578
70.5669104194136WP_Hook->do_action( $args = [0 => ''] ).../plugin.php:517
80.5669104194136WP_Hook->apply_filters( $value = '', $args = [0 => ''] ).../class-wp-hook.php:348
90.8250139997320hustle_init( '' ).../class-wp-hook.php:324
100.8250139997360Opt_In->__construct( ).../popover.php:257
110.8252140011720Hustle_Init->__construct( ).../popover.php:210
120.8412143495704Hustle_Module_Front->__construct( ).../hustle-init.php:72
130.8416143557616Hustle_Module_Front->prepare_for_front( ).../hustle-module-front.php:102
140.8417143566384Hustle_Provider_Autoload::initiate_providers( ).../hustle-module-front.php:114
150.8419143614880Hustle_Providers::get_instance( ).../class-hustle-provider-autoload.php:107
160.8419143615024Hustle_Providers->__construct( ).../hustle-providers.php:41
170.8421143630880__( $text = 'Failed to activate addon', $domain = 'hustle' ).../hustle-providers.php:104
180.8421143630880translate( $text = 'Failed to activate addon', $domain = 'hustle' ).../l10n.php:307
190.8421143630880get_translations_for_domain( $domain = 'hustle' ).../l10n.php:195
200.8421143630880_load_textdomain_just_in_time( $domain = 'hustle' ).../l10n.php:1409
210.8423143632024_doing_it_wrong( $function_name = '_load_textdomain_just_in_time', $message = 'Translation loading for the <code>hustle</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later.', $version = '6.7.0' ).../l10n.php:1371
220.8423143633368wp_trigger_error( $function_name = '', $message = '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>hustle</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.0.)', $error_level = ??? ).../functions.php:6061
230.8424143634008trigger_error( $message = 'Function _load_textdomain_just_in_time was called <strong>incorrectly</strong>. Translation loading for the <code>hustle</code> domain was triggered too early. This is usually an indicator for some code in the plugin or theme running too early. Translations should be loaded at the <code>init</code> action or later. Please see <a href="https://developer.wordpress.org/advanced-administration/debug/debug-wordpress/">Debugging in WordPress</a> for more information. (This message was added in version 6.7.0.)', $error_level = 1024 ).../functions.php:6121

( ! ) Warning: Cannot modify header information - headers already sent by (output started at /srv/www/advital/current/web/wp/wp-includes/functions.php:6121) in /srv/www/advital/current/web/app/plugins/wp-recipe-maker/includes/public/class-wprm-print.php on line 127
Call Stack
#TimeMemoryFunctionLocation
10.0002464728{main}( ).../index.php:0
20.0003466040require( '/srv/www/advital/current/web/wp/wp-blog-header.php ).../index.php:5
30.0004475664require_once( '/srv/www/advital/current/web/wp/wp-load.php ).../wp-blog-header.php:13
40.0005477056require_once( '/srv/www/advital/current/web/wp-config.php ).../wp-load.php:55
50.01271211296require_once( '/srv/www/advital/current/web/wp/wp-settings.php ).../wp-config.php:9
60.9053153459792do_action( $hook_name = 'init' ).../wp-settings.php:727
70.9053153460008WP_Hook->do_action( $args = [0 => ''] ).../plugin.php:517
80.9053153460008WP_Hook->apply_filters( $value = '', $args = [0 => ''] ).../class-wp-hook.php:348
91.2734186248624WPRM_Print::print_page( '' ).../class-wp-hook.php:324
101.3048186774104header( $header = 'HTTP/1.1 200 OK' ).../class-wprm-print.php:127
Homemade Cheese Sauce Recipe - AdVital
Go Back

Homemade Cheese Sauce Recipe

Our velvety cheddar sauce is a great source of protein and calcium, and goes perfectly with everything from beef nachos to creamy macaroni.
5 from 2 votes
Prep Time 5 minutes
Cook Time 30 minutes
Total Time 35 minutes
Course Condiments
Cuisine General
Servings 18
Energy 1100kJ

Ingredients

  • 100 g plain flour
  • 100 g unsalted butter
  • 1 L milk
  • 200 g AdVital Nutritionally Complete Neutral Powder, 8 Scoops
  • 150 g cheddar cheese, grated
  • 1/2 tsp nutmeg, ground
  • Salt and pepper, to taste

Instructions
 

  • Heat the milk and nutmeg in a saucepan over a low heat until milk starts to simmer. Remove the saucepan from the heat.
  • Heat the butter in a second saucepan over a low to medium heat until it is fully melted. Add the flour. Cook the mixture, stirring it with a wooden spoon, for 2 minutes (or until it starts to bubble). Remove the saucepan from the heat. Slowly add the milk, one ladle at a time, and stir the mixture constantly to prevent lumps.
  • Return the saucepan to a low heat. Cook the mixture for 20 minutes (or until sauce boils and thickens), and stir to avoid the mixture sticking to the bottom and burning.
  •  Stir in the cheese until the mixture is smooth. Remove the saucepan from the heat. Season the sauce with salt and pepper to taste.

Notes

Tips and Hints:
  • If there are lumps in the final sauce, use a hand blender to remove them.
Low FODMAP Diet Tips:
  • If a low FODMAP diet is being followed, use the Monash University FODMAP Diet App to find suitable low FODMAP ingredient alternatives.

Nutrition

Nutrition Facts
Homemade Cheese Sauce Recipe
Serving Size
 
135 g
Amount per Serving
Energy
 
1100
kJ
14
%
Calories
262
% Daily Value*
Protein
 
14.5
g
29
%
Fat
 
15.8
g
24
%
Saturated Fat
 
10.3
g
64
%
Carbohydrates
 
15.2
g
5
%
Fiber
 
0.3
g
1
%
Sugar
 
6.1
g
7
%
Sodium
 
217
mg
9
%
Potassium
 
190
mg
5
%
* Percent Daily Values are based on a 8000 kJ diet.
Keyword Dairy, Dips, Fortified Recipe, Sauce, Vegetarian
Tried this recipe?Let us know how it was!